Bendrų aplankų nustatymas „VirtualBox“
Jei „VirtualBox“ turite įdiegę virtualias mašinas, greičiausiai norite bendrinti duomenis tarp VM ir pagrindinės operacinės sistemos. „VirtualBox“ naudodamasi „Shared Folder“ funkcija galite bendrinti aplanką tarp pagrindinės ir svečios operacinės sistemos.
Mes naudosime „Windows 10“ pagrindinę sistemą ir bendrinsime aplanką su „Ubuntu 18“.04 kaip svečias. Viskas, pradedant skaitymo ir rašymo leidimais, baigiant tūrio valdymu, stebėtinai lengva ir paprasta nustatyti bet kuriuo atveju. „Linux“ ir ne „Linux“ OS taip pat siūlo gražų bendrumą, todėl šie žingsniai yra plačiai pritaikomi.
Mes bendrinsime aplanką pavadinimu D: \ VboxShare iš priimančiosios sistemos tuo pačiu pavadinimu ant svečio, siekiant paprastumo. Jei norite, galite bendrinamą aplanką svečio OS rodyti kitu pavadinimu.
Paleiskite savo VM ir spustelėkite „Devices“ parinktis „VirtualBox“ lango viršutinėje eilutėje.
Apatinio meniu „Devices“ apačioje gausite parinktį Įterpti svečių pridėjimų kompaktinio disko vaizdą .. spustelėkite jį ir jis prijungs „Oracle“ pateiktą iso failą, kad išplėstų VM galimybes, įskaitant funkciją „Bendras aplankas“.
Spustelėjus gali atsitikti vienas iš dviejų dalykų. Jei naudojate atsarginę „Ubuntu“, būsite paraginti, kad yra automatinis paleidimas.sh scenarijų, esantį kompaktinio disko atvaizde, ir norint paleisti reikia sudo slaptažodžio, galite pastebėti, kad tik jūsų failų sistemoje yra įdiegtas kompaktinio disko vaizdas, tokiu atveju prašome žiūrėti toliau pateiktą pastabą.
Grįžtant prie idealaus atvejo, kai automatinis paleidimas.sh scenarijus paleidžiamas atskirai, tokiu atveju turėtumėte leisti svečiam OS paleisti scenarijų. Spustelėkite „Vykdyti“, kai pasirodys šis langas:
Galite tęsti ir įvesti savo sudo slaptažodį, kai pamatysite šį raginimą:
Galiausiai pamatysite diegimo rezultatą (tai užtruks tik kelias sekundes):
Jūs pastebėsite, kad scenarijus prašo jūsų įdiegti gcc, make and perl kad galėtų įdiegti reikiamus branduolio modulius. Mes tai padarysime toliau.
Pastaba: jei automatinio diegimo raginimas nerodomas
Yra tikimybė, kad naudojate platinimą, pvz., „Lubuntu“, ir pastebėsite, kad ant kelio pritvirtintas naujas kompaktinio disko vaizdas / media /
$ sudo ./ autorun.sh
Žinoma, jums reikės naudoti savo vartotojo vardą vietoj
Grįžti į diegimą
Dabar atėjo laikas įsitikinti, kad „Guest Addition“ programinė įranga turi visus reikalingus bazinius paketus, kad įdiegtų branduolio modulius svečių OS. Kaip minėta anksčiau, šie paketai yra padaryti, gcc ir perl. Įdiekime juos.
$ sudo apt install gcc make perlDabar, kaip paskutinį smulkmenos tašką, turite suprasti, kad prie „VirtualBox“ bendrinamų failų gali prisijungti tik vboxsf grupė, kurią anksčiau sukūrė automatinis paleidimas.sh scenarijus. Kad šie failai būtų prieinami įprastai UNIX vartotojo abonementui, ta paskyra turi būti vboxsf grupė. Padarykite tai įvykdę komandą:
$ sudo adduser
Pridedamas bendrinamas aplankas
Dabar esame pasirengę bendrinti aplankus iš pagrindinio kompiuterio. Norėdami tai padaryti, spustelėkite VM lango meniu parinktį VirtualBox dar kartą. (Viršutinė eilutė, už VM ribų)
Ten pamatysite šias parinktis: Įrenginiai → Bendrinami aplankai → Bendrinamų aplankų nustatymai ..
Spustelėję jį pamatysite kažką panašaus į šį:
Spustelėkite pirmojo aplanko piktogramą dešiniajame stulpelyje. Tada įveskite kelią į tą aplanką, kaip matote iš pagrindinės kompiuterio operacinės sistemos. Mūsų atveju tai yra aplankas D: diske. Tada Aplanko pavadinimas kintamasis nuspręs, kokį pavadinimą turės tas bendras aplankas viduje VM. Taip pat galite pasirinkti parinktį Automatiškai pritvirtinti, kad aplankas būtų prijungtas be rankinio įsikišimo. Jei tapsite nuolatiniu nariu, užtikrinsite, kad bendrinimas bus įjungtas kiekvieną kartą paleidus tą VM.
Jei aplanke esantys duomenys yra neskelbtini arba jei naudojate savo VM kenkėjiškos programinės įrangos testavimui, galbūt norėsite pasirinkti ir tik skaitymo parinktį. Tai atlikdami įsitikinkite, kad VM negali modifikuoti aplanko turinio.
Dabar mes perkrauname savo sistemą, kad visi pakeitimai, kuriuos atlikome per kelis paskutinius veiksmus, iš tikrųjų būtų rodomi kaip bendras aplankas mūsų vartotojo darbalaukyje (arba / media /
Išvada
Praneškite mums, ar jūsų bendrinamuose aplankuose yra kokių nors kitų klaidų, problemų ar nustatymų. Jei yra kraštinis atvejis, kurį norite aprėpti, jei vis dar turite tam tikrų abejonių dėl aukščiau aprašytų veiksmų.
Galite susisiekti su mumis „Twitter“, „Facebook“ arba užsiprenumeruoti mus el. Paštu.